SSL证书(Secure Sockets Layer Certificate)是一种用于在网站上实现数据加密和身份验证的数字证书。通过为网站添加SSL证书,可以确保用户在访问网站时数据传输的安全性,防止数据被窃取或篡改。以下是为网站添加SSL证书的基本步骤和相关信息:
SSL证书是由受信任的第三方机构(称为证书颁发机构,CA)颁发的数字证书。它包含网站的公钥和一些其他信息,如网站的域名、颁发机构、有效期等。当用户访问一个使用SSL证书的网站时,浏览器会与服务器进行握手,验证证书的有效性,并建立一个加密通道来保护数据传输。
以下是一个在Nginx服务器上安装SSL证书的示例配置:
server {
listen 80;
server_name example.com;
return 301 https://$host$request_uri;
}
server {
listen 443 ssl;
server_name example.com;
ssl_certificate /path/to/certificate.crt;
ssl_certificate_key /path/to/private.key;
location / {
root /var/www/html;
index index.html index.htm;
}
}
通过以上步骤和信息,你应该能够成功为你的网站添加SSL证书,并确保数据传输的安全性。
领取专属 10元无门槛券
手把手带您无忧上云